Drivers hurt on Saturday returning home

By JIM UTTER

ThatsRacin.com Writer


HAMPTON, Ga. - Driver Hank Parker Jr. was discharged Sunday from Atlanta Medical Center, where he and three other drivers were taken after crashes in Saturday's NASCAR Craftsman Truck Series race at Atlanta Motor Speedway.
Parker Jr. was undergoing treatment for a crushed vertebra, hospital officials said. After his release about noon (Eastern), he was expected to return to his home in the Charlotte, N.C., area.

He sustained the injury in an accident that also sent Rick Crawford and Tina Gordon to the hospital.

Crawford suffered broken bones in his left foot and Gordon broke a bone in her lower-right leg. Both were released Saturday.

Joey Clanton was involved in an unrelated accident and went to the hospital for a precautionary CT scan. He was also released Saturday.
